#include <iostream>
#include <vector>
int main() {
unsigned n, a, b;
std::cout << "a="; std::cin >> a;
std::cout << "b="; std::cin >> b;
std::cout << "n="; std::cin >> n;
std::vector<int> v;
while (n % 3 != 0) {
if (a < n && n < b) {
v.push_back(n);
}
std::cout << "n="; std::cin >> n;
}
std::cout << "No. of numbers from the interval " << v.size() << std::endl;
std::cout << "The numbers from the interval:" << std::endl;
for (std::size_t i = 0; i != v.size(); ++i) {
std::cout << v[i] << " ";
}
return 0;
}
I2luY2x1ZGUgPGlvc3RyZWFtPgojaW5jbHVkZSA8dmVjdG9yPgoKaW50IG1haW4oKSB7CiAgICB1bnNpZ25lZCBuLCBhLCBiOwogICAgc3RkOjpjb3V0IDw8ICJhPSI7IHN0ZDo6Y2luID4+IGE7CiAgICBzdGQ6OmNvdXQgPDwgImI9Ijsgc3RkOjpjaW4gPj4gYjsKICAgIHN0ZDo6Y291dCA8PCAibj0iOyBzdGQ6OmNpbiA+PiBuOwogICAgc3RkOjp2ZWN0b3I8aW50PiB2OwogICAgd2hpbGUgKG4gJSAzICE9IDApIHsKICAgICAgICBpZiAoYSA8IG4gJiYgbiA8IGIpIHsKICAgICAgICAgICAgdi5wdXNoX2JhY2sobik7CiAgICAgICAgfQogICAgICAgIHN0ZDo6Y291dCA8PCAibj0iOyBzdGQ6OmNpbiA+PiBuOwogICAgfQoKICAgIHN0ZDo6Y291dCA8PCAiTm8uIG9mIG51bWJlcnMgZnJvbSB0aGUgaW50ZXJ2YWwgIiA8PCB2LnNpemUoKSA8PCBzdGQ6OmVuZGw7CiAgICBzdGQ6OmNvdXQgPDwgIlRoZSBudW1iZXJzIGZyb20gdGhlIGludGVydmFsOiIgPDwgc3RkOjplbmRsOwogICAgZm9yIChzdGQ6OnNpemVfdCBpID0gMDsgaSAhPSB2LnNpemUoKTsgKytpKSB7CiAgICAgICAgc3RkOjpjb3V0IDw8IHZbaV0gPDwgIiAiOwogICAgfQogICAgcmV0dXJuIDA7Cn0K